feat: implement generic many-to-many junction relation support (#16820)

## Overview

This PR implements **generic many-to-many relation support** through
junction tables (also known as associative entities or join tables).
This replaces the need for hardcoded taskTarget/noteTarget logic and
provides a flexible foundation for modeling complex entity
relationships.

## Architecture

### Data Model

Many-to-many relationships are implemented using a **junction object
pattern**:

```
┌─────────┐       ┌──────────────────┐       ┌─────────┐
│  Pet    │──────>│   PetRocket      │<──────│ Rocket  │
│         │ 1:N   │  (junction)      │  N:1  │         │
│ rockets ├───────┤ pet    : Pet     ├───────┤         │
└─────────┘       │ rocket : Rocket  │       └─────────┘
                  └──────────────────┘
```

The junction object (PetRocket) has:
- A `MANY_TO_ONE` relation to **Pet** (the source)
- A `MANY_TO_ONE` relation to **Rocket** (the target)

The source object (Pet) has a `ONE_TO_MANY` relation pointing to the
junction, with **field settings** that specify which target field to
follow.

### Field Settings Schema

Junction configuration is stored in `FieldMetadataRelationSettings`:

```typescript
{
  relationType: "ONE_TO_MANY",
  // Points to the target field on the junction object
  junctionTargetFieldId?: string;      // For regular relations
  junctionTargetMorphId?: string;      // For polymorphic relations
}
```

**Two configuration modes:**
1. **`junctionTargetFieldId`** - References a specific `RELATION` field
on the junction
2. **`junctionTargetMorphId`** - References a `morphId` group for
polymorphic targets (e.g., link to Person OR Company)

### GraphQL Query Generation

When a junction relation is detected, the GraphQL fields are generated
to fetch the nested target:

```graphql
query GetPetWithRockets {
  pet(id: "...") {
    rockets {           # ONE_TO_MANY to junction
      id
      rocket {          # Target field on junction
        id
        name
        __typename
      }
    }
  }
}
```

For polymorphic junction targets:
```graphql
caretakerPerson { id, name }
caretakerCompany { id, name }
```

## Frontend Architecture

### Display Flow

1. **Detection**: `hasJunctionConfig()` checks if field has junction
settings
2. **Config Resolution**: `getJunctionConfig()` resolves junction object
metadata and target fields
3. **Record Extraction**: `extractTargetRecordsFromJunction()` extracts
target records from junction records
4. **Rendering**: Target records displayed as chips (not junction
records)

### Edit Flow

1. **Picker Opening**: Initializes the multi-record picker with:
   - Searchable object types (derived from junction target fields)
   - Pre-selected items (extracted from existing junction records)
   
2. **Selection Handling**: Manages create/delete of junction records:
   - **Select**: Creates new junction record with source + target IDs
   - **Deselect**: Finds and deletes the junction record
- **Optimistic Updates**: Manually updates Recoil store before API call

### Key Trade-offs

| Decision | Trade-off |
|----------|-----------|
| Junction records managed manually | More control over optimistic
updates, but requires manual cache management |
| Settings stored per-field | Flexible (same junction can power
different views), but requires UI to configure |
| Polymorphic via morphId groups | Supports N target types, but adds
query complexity |
| Feature flag gated | Safe rollout, but requires flag management |

## Backend Changes

- **Validation**: Junction target field must exist and be a valid
`MANY_TO_ONE` relation
- **Settings**: Extended `FieldMetadataRelationSettings` type with
junction fields
- **Dev Seeder**: Added sample junction objects (PetRocket,
EmploymentHistory, PetCareAgreement) for testing

## How to Test

1. Enable the `IS_JUNCTION_RELATIONS_ENABLED` feature flag
2. Create objects with junction pattern (Pet → PetRocket → Rocket)
3. Configure the junction target in field settings (advanced mode)
4. Verify:
- Display shows target objects (Rockets), not junction records
(PetRockets)
   - Picker allows selecting/deselecting targets
   - Changes persist correctly
